Parent Volunteer

We greatly appreciate and are always in need of parent volunteers to support our student field trips.  CPS Policy requires a ratio of 1 adult volunteer for every 10 students (1:10) on field trips.
 
Volunteer Level Requirement:
 
Level I (Preferred):   Volunteers who have completed the comprehensive background check are strongly preferred, as they allow for greater flexibility in assisting students.
 
Level II (Needed):  Volunteers who have completed the initial background check are also needed and valued.

As we prepare for the new school year, please be aware that all volunteers are removed from the system at the end of June. If you would like to continue volunteering for field trips or other school activities, you will need to reapply when classes begin in August.

 

CPS requires all volunteers be approved prior to chaperoning fieldtrips or participating in school activities.  It is recommended that potential chaperones begin the process a month before of a scheduled ​field trip or a school event.

 

Please Note:

  • To be approved, you must reapply each school year.

  • Your application is only complete if you select Gray Elementary.

  • A fingerprint criminal background check is not required for Level II Volunteers.

NEW VOLUNTEERS
Follow these steps to create a NEW application for the school year. 
1. You must create an account.
2. Log in.
3. Under the "APPLICATION" tab select "ADD NEW  APPLICATION"  
(Enter the volunteer level and personal information).
4. After submitting your application, please take your picture ID to the office in the Primary Building (Door #1) so it can be submitted and ...
 
• Level I volunteers

Volunteer will received an email that outlines the next steps. This includes: Fingerprinting, Background Check, SafeSchools training, TB test (which must be updated every two years.)

 
• Level II volunteers
Make sure to check email as well as status in account.  This school year, completing the online Level II training is mandatory for all volunteers to receive approval. The training takes just 20 minutes.
